Jerry Gana congratulates Wike on achievements, says projects him as Nigeria’s future leader
A member of the Board of Trustees (BoT) of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DDP), Professor Jerry Gana, on Friday congratulated Governor Nyesom Wike of Rivers State on his achievements in project development in Rivers, project the Rivers governor as potential president in the country.
Professor Gana, commending Wike for his “sustained emphasis on development projects”, asserted that such quality makes the Rivers governor a prospect for Nigeria’s presidency.
Prof. Gana at the flag-off of a flyover in Obio/Akpor, declared: “Your sustained emphasis on development projects has shown clearly that good governance is possible through good leadership. You have demonstrated the power of good leadership in delivering development projects to the people of Rivers State.
“Please, accept our congratulations on this kind of good leadership that performs. You have a bright future. I am not a prophet but you have a bright future. If some people have disappointed you this time around, don’t worry, your future is bright. Age is on your side. You will preside over Nigeria someday.”
Professor Gana maintained that for Rivers State residents to continue enjoying such “good leadership”, they have to queue behind the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) governorship candidate. Siminialayi Fubara, in the 2023 general elections.
“Let me now ask the good people of Rivers State – very wonderful people – to ensure that in the forthcoming elections you vote massively for the candidate of our party who is being supported by this performing governor so that they will be continuity; so that the good things he is doing here can be continued by the next set of people that are going to govern this place,” he told the gathering.
“Don’t make the mistake of throwing away your votes to another party. The PDP will never let you down. We shall do well, excel, perform, and be trustworthy. So, we plead with you in the forthcoming election to ensure that the candidates of our party are supported and elected,” {rof Gana said.
The PDP BoT member also told Governor Wike not to be disappointed over the loss of the PDP presidential ricket to former Vice President Atiku Abubakar at the party’s presidential primaries.
“Therefore, we want you to stay firm, stay within the PDP, and never waiver because so many people outside Rivers State are looking up to you,” Gana said.
